Transparency = Trust

We live in the age of transparency.

Buyers rely on crowd-sourced information to fuel their decisions more than ever before, while clients are equally empowered to share their stories and perceptions with the world at large.

As a service provider, it can be easy to default to a protective mentality... to batten down the hatches and take a command-and-control approach to managing client relationships and brand reputation. 

But there's no easier way to build trust and win loyalty with your clients - and certainly no easier way to instill trust in the minds of your buyers - than to embrace the transparency dynamic and all of the vulnerable, meaningful, and honest discussions that come with it.

Companies like Lyft and AirBnB are living proof that humans are ready and willing to challenge standard ways of doing business when they have access to credible, meaningful information
